About Sr Mgr Jc45-Software Quality Assurance Analysts And Tester
The role of Sr Mgr Jc45-Software Quality Assurance Analysts and Testers is pivotal in ensuring the quality and reliability of software products. Professionals in this position are responsible for leading QA teams, developing testing strategies, and implementing quality assurance processes. Key responsibilities include designing test plans, overseeing automated and manual testing, and collaborating with development teams to resolve issues. Required skills typically include expertise in software testing methodologies, strong analytical abilities, and proficiency in programming languages. With an average salary of approximately $120K and 126 H-1B positions available in 2024, this role presents significant opportunities for international professionals seeking visa sponsorship. The demand for skilled QA analysts is growing, driven by the increasing reliance on software across industries, making this an attractive career path with promising growth potential.

💰 Salary Trends & Insights
The salary trends for Sr Mgr Jc45-Software Quality Assurance Analysts and Testers show a slight decline in average salaries from 2022 to 2024, with an overall average of $121,706. In 2022, the average salary was $122,737, decreasing to $121,733 in 2023, and slightly lower at $121,535 in 2024. The peak hiring months in 2024 were July and August, with 17 and 22 job postings respectively, reflecting strong market demand. Notably, salaries peaked in November 2024 at $132,881, indicating a potential recovery in compensation trends towards the end of the year.
